Branch O Goss 1910 - 1972

Branch O Goss of Gideon, New Madrid County, MO was born on January 1, 1910, and died at age 62 years old on November 4, 1972. Branch Goss was buried at Memphis National Cemetery Section B Site 1675 3568 Townes Avenue, in Memphis, Tn.

In 1910, in the year that Branch O Goss was born, Angel Island, which is in San Francisco Bay, became the immigration center for Asians entering U.S. It was often referred to as "The Ellis Island of the West". Due to restrictive laws against Chinese immigration, many immigrants spent years on the island.

In 1934, Branch was 24 years old when on June 6th, the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ission was formed as a response to the stock market crash of 1929 and the continuing Great Depression. Previously, the states regulated the offering and sales of stocks - called "blue sky" laws. They were largely ineffective. Roosevelt created a group (one member was Joseph Kennedy, father of the future President Kennedy) who knew Wall Street well and they defined the mission and operating mode for the SEC. The new organization had broad and stringent rules and oversight and restored public confidence in the stock market in the United States.
